Understanding Temazepam Treatment in the United States: A Comprehensive GuideSleep disorders are a considerable public health concern in the United States, impacting millions of grownups throughout numerous demographics. Amongst the numerous therapeutic interventions offered, Temazepam remains a frequently prescribed medicinal alternative. Sold most significantly under the brand name Restoril, Temazepam comes from a class of medications called benzodiazepines. This article supplies a thorough look at Temazepam treatment within the US medical landscape, covering its usage, regulative status, risks, and clinical standards.What is Temazepam?Temazepam is a sedative-hypnotic medication particularly designed to treat insomnia. Unlike some other benzodiazepines that are used primarily for anxiety or seizures, Temazepam is chemically customized to target the sleep-wake cycle. It was first patented in 1962 and entered medical usage in the United States in the early 1980s.System of ActionTemazepam works by improving the impacts of g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) in the brain. GABA is an inhibitory neurotransmitter that decreases neuronal excitability throughout the nerve system. By binding to specific GABA-A receptors, Temazepam increases the frequency of the opening of chloride channels, leading to a calming impact on the central worried system (CNS). This leads to:Reduced time to drop off to sleep (sleep latency).Decreased number of nighttime awakenings.Increased total sleep period.Medical Indications and DosageIn the United States,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has actually authorized Temazepam for the short-term treatment of sleeping disorders. "Short-term" is generally specified as 7 to 10 days of constant usage. It is indicated for patients who have problem dropping off to sleep or staying asleep.Standard Dosage FormsTemazepam is generally administered in capsule form. The dosage prescribed by healthcare companies in the US differs based upon the client's age, medical condition, and action to the treatment.Table 1: Standard Temazepam Dosage Strengths in the USADose StrengthUsually Prescribed ForNotes7.5 mgSenior or debilitated patientsDecreases danger of next-day grogginess and falls.15 mgStandard adult beginning dosageTypical for mild to moderate sleeping disorders.22.5 mgIntermediate adult dosageUsed when 15 mg is insufficient but 30 mg is too high.30 mgSevere sleeping disorders in healthy grownupsMaximum suggested dosage for most outpatients.The Regulatory Framework in the USADue to the fact that Temazepam has a potential for misuse, reliance, and diversion, it is strictly controlled in the United States.FDA Categorization: It is an FDA-approved prescription medication. It can not be acquired over the counter.DEA Scheduling: Under the Controlled Substances Act, the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) categorizes Temazepam as a Schedule IV controlled substance. This indicates it has actually an acknowledged medical use however also a capacity for abuse and low to moderate risk of physical or mental reliance.Prescription Limitations: In many states, prescriptions for Schedule IV substances are limited to 5 refills within a six-month duration, after which a new physical assessment and prescription are needed.Side Effects and Safety ProfileWhile efficient, Temazepam is associated with a number of side impacts. Healthcare suppliers in the United States are required to counsel clients on these dangers before initiating treatment.Typical Side EffectsA lot of clients experience moderate adverse effects, which might consist of:Drowsiness or "hangover" feeling the next day.Dizziness or lightheadedness.Queasiness.Headache.Nervousness or irritation.Major Risks and Complex Sleep BehaviorsThe FDA has actually released warnings relating to "complicated sleep habits." Clients taking Temazepam have reported taking part in activities while asleep that they do not remember, such as:Sleep-walking.Sleep-driving.Preparing and eating food while asleep.Making call.If a client experiences any of these behaviors, the medication must be terminated right away.Contrast with Other Sleep MedicationsWhen dealing with insomnia in the United States, doctors typically select between benzodiazepines (like Temazepam) and "Z-drugs" (like Zolpidem).Table 2: Temazepam vs. Common AlternativesFunctionTemazepam (Restoril)Zolpidem (Ambien)Melatonin (OTC)Drug ClassBenzodiazepineNon-benzodiazepine SedativeNatural Hormone/SupplementStart of Action45-- 60 minutes15-- 30 minutes30-- 60 minutesPeriod of Effect7-- 8 hours (Intermediate)6-- 8 hours (Short)VariablePrescription NeededYesYesNoRisk of DependencyModerateLow to ModerateNoneRequired Precautions and ContraindicationsSpecific populations in the US should work out severe care or prevent Temazepam entirely:The Elderly: According to the Beers Criteria (a guideline for medications for seniors), benzodiazepines like Temazepam must normally be prevented in older adults due to the high risk of cognitive impairment, delirium, falls, and fractures.Pregnancy: Temazepam is typically contraindicated during pregnancy (previously FDA Category X) as it may trigger fetal harm.Alcohol Consumption: Alcohol significantly increases the sedative effects of Temazepam. Integrating the 2 can cause breathing anxiety, coma, or death.Breathing Issues: Patients with sleep apnea or chronic obstructive lung illness (COPD) might experience aggravated symptoms.Management of Dependency and WithdrawalBecause the body can establish a tolerance to Temazepam, its efficiency may reduce if used longer than 2 weeks. In addition, stopping the drug suddenly after prolonged usage can cause withdrawal signs.Typical Withdrawal Symptoms consist of:Rebound sleeping disorders (sleeping disorders that is worse than before treatment).Tremors and muscle cramps.Anxiety and panic attacks.Sweating and increased heart rate.In extreme cases, seizures.In the US, medical best practices determine a "tapering" process, where the dosage is gradually reduced under medical supervision to ensure patient safety.Best Practices for PatientsTo take full advantage of the benefits and decrease the dangers of Temazepam treatment, patients must follow these guidelines:Take right before bed: Only take the medication when you are all set to get a complete 7 to 8 hours of sleep.Prevent high-fat meals: Taking Temazepam with a heavy, high-fat meal can postpone its start.No "Double-Dosing": If a dose is missed out on, do not take two doses the next night.Routine Consultation: Keep all follow-up appointments with your healthcare supplier to assess if the medication is still necessary.Temazepam stays a cornerstone of short-term sleeping disorders treatment in the United States. While it is highly efficient at inducing and maintaining sleep, its status as an illegal drug highlights the requirement for mindful medical oversight.
